Half-Day Rethymno Quad Safari





Description
Head up to the mountains and into the wild Cretan nature on this half-day quad safari. You will travel through shallow waters and through impressive gorges featuring amazing archaeological formations. You will encounter some incredible wildlife and visit some traditional 11th and 12th century Cretan villages that are not spotted on the map. Make several stops on the route, including a stop at a traditional kafeneion (traditional Greek coffeehouse). Travel with peace of mind with hotel pickup and drop-off included within certain limits (30km) arround Rethymnon.
